1. Cross-Platform Compatibility
One of the most notable advantages of HTML5 gaming is its universal compatibility. Unlike native apps that must be developed separately for iOS, Android, Windows, and other platforms, HTML5 games can run directly in any modern web browser, regardless of the operating system or device.
Benefits:
- No downloads or installations required
- Works on desktop, tablets, and smartphones
- Players can switch between devices with synced progress (with cloud support)
- Games can be embedded into websites, social media, and apps
2. Instant Play (No App Stores Needed)
HTML5 games are accessible instantly—no need to wait for an app to install or go through an app store. With just a click, users can jump into the action.
Why this matters:
- Reduces friction and drop-off in user acquisition funnels
- Bypasses app store restrictions, approvals, and commission fees
- Ideal for microgaming, quizzes, tournaments, and viral content
3. Faster Development and Maintenance
Developers love HTML5 for its streamlined coding process and ability to reuse code across multiple platforms.
Key advantages:
- Write once, deploy everywhere
- Easier to maintain and update games in real-time
- Lower development costs compared to native apps
- Vast ecosystem of tools, libraries, and frameworks (like Phaser, CreateJS, or PixiJS)

5. Offline Play with Caching
With the support of HTML5 local storage and caching, games can be played offline after their first load. This enhances user experience for regions with inconsistent internet access.
Why it matters:
- Play anytime, anywhere
- Adds convenience and boosts engagement
- Keeps users in the game loop even when offline
6. Monetization Flexibility
HTML5 games provide publishers and developers with a variety of monetization methods beyond traditional in-app purchases.
Monetization options include:
- Interstitial and rewarded video ads
- Subscription models
- Branded games and sponsorships
- Microtransactions and in-game currency
Unlike traditional app stores that take a cut of your revenue, web-based HTML5 games give developers more control and profit.

8. Future-Proof and Open Standard
HTML5 is not owned by any single company, which means it’s governed by open web standards and constantly evolving through community contributions. This gives it a stable, sustainable foundation for long-term growth.
Why this ensures longevity:
- Avoids reliance on proprietary tech
- Backed by major tech players like Google, Apple, and Microsoft
- Supports integration with AR, VR, and WebGL for next-gen gaming
